JavaScript is evolving. Functional Programming (FP) isn't just a trend; it's a powerful paradigm for building reliable software by treating it as a predictable flow of data. By embracing principles like purity and immutability, you'll write more dependable JavaScript. This hands-on guide will walk you from the "why" to the "how" of functional JavaScript. You'll learn to manage side effects, build elegant data pipelines, handle errors confidently, and structure applications in a clean, testable, and high-performing way. ...
Read More
JavaScript is evolving. Functional Programming (FP) isn't just a trend; it's a powerful paradigm for building reliable software by treating it as a predictable flow of data. By embracing principles like purity and immutability, you'll write more dependable JavaScript. This hands-on guide will walk you from the "why" to the "how" of functional JavaScript. You'll learn to manage side effects, build elegant data pipelines, handle errors confidently, and structure applications in a clean, testable, and high-performing way. This book is about writing better JavaScript, starting now. Tired of fixing a bug in one place only to see another break? Frustrated with complex, fragile code? That's the pain of traditional imperative programming. Functional programming offers a better way, using small, predictable, independent pieces-like Lego bricks-to build complex logic with confidence. This book is your map to escape the tangled web and write code that inspires confidence, not fear. WHAT'S INSIDE: This book is a hands-on journey from core concepts to a complete application: Shift Your Mindset: Understand the three pillars of FP: Purity, Immutability, and Composition. Master JavaScript's Functional Tools: Master first-class functions and the essential array methods: map, filter, and reduce. Tame Side Effects: Identify and isolate impurities and boost performance with memoization. Learn the Art of Composition: Build your own pipe and compose utilities to create elegant data pipelines. Conquer Asynchronicity: Move from "Callback Hell" to clean, composable Promises and async/await. Build Resilient, Crash-Proof Code: Build your own Maybe and Either containers to handle errors functionally. Put It All Together: Apply everything you've learned to build a complete data-fetching application. Look to the Future: Demystify advanced topics like Functors and Monads, and explore libraries like Ramda and fp-ts. WHO IT'S MEANT FOR: This book is for the pragmatic JavaScript developer who wants a better way: Front-end and back-end developers struggling with complex state. Those who have heard of "pure functions" and "immutability" but need a practical guide. Developers who want to write code that is easier to test, debug, and understand . Anyone ready to level up their skills with a highly valued paradigm. You just need a solid grasp of JavaScript fundamentals. Stop fighting your code. The path to cleaner, more confident JavaScript is here. This book will change your relationship with code for the better. Ready to build applications you can trust? Let's begin.
Read Less
Add this copy of Javascript Functional Programming to cart. £19.84, new condition, Sold by Paperbackshop International rated 5.0 out of 5 stars, ships from Fairford, GLOS, UNITED KINGDOM, published 2025 by Amazon Digital Services LLC-Kdp.
Choose your shipping method in Checkout. Costs may vary based on destination.
Seller's Description:
PLEASE NOTE, WE DO NOT SHIP TO DENMARK. New Book. Shipped from UK in 4 to 14 days. Established seller since 2000. Please note we cannot offer an expedited shipping service from the UK.
Add this copy of JavaScript Functional Programming: A Hands-on Guide to to cart. £21.07, new condition, Sold by Ingram Customer Returns Center rated 5.0 out of 5 stars, ships from NV, USA, published 2025 by Independently Published.
Add this copy of Javascript Functional Programming: a Hands-on Guide to to cart. £23.50, new condition, Sold by Just one more Chapter rated 4.0 out of 5 stars, ships from Miramar, FL, UNITED STATES, published 2025 by Independently published.